Key Responsibilities
As the IT Site Director at arenaflex, you will be entrusted with comprehensive leadership responsibilities that directly impact operational excellence. Your daily activities will encompass a wide range of technical and managerial duties designed to maintain and enhance our fulfillment center's technology infrastructure.
Operational Leadership
Direct and manage all daily activities of the IT division at the Dallas Fulfillment Center, ensuring alignment with organizational goals and operational requirements
Lead, mentor, and develop a team of local IT Support Specialists, fostering a culture of excellence, collaboration, and continuous improvement
Coordinate with regional and corporate IT leadership to implement strategic initiatives and maintain consistent technology standards across all facilities
Establish and maintain effective working relationships with operations management, ensuring IT services meet business needs and support operational efficiency
Create and maintain comprehensive documentation for all IT systems, processes, and procedures
Technical Support and Problem Resolution
Investigate and resolve complex application, hardware, and network issues that impact fulfillment center operations
Perform thorough analysis, documentation, and resolution of escalated help desk tickets, ensuring timely and effective solutions
Troubleshoot issues involving desktops, laptops, RF scanning devices, network infrastructure, Windows operating systems, and specialized fulfillment technology
Provide advanced technical support in a multi-user, high-pressure environment while maintaining service level agreements (SLAs)
Collaborate with both local and remote IT Support Specialists to deliver comprehensive technology solutions
Infrastructure Management
Manage and maintain network engineering functions, including design, implementation, and troubleshooting
Oversee data cabling and PC facilities maintenance to ensure reliable connectivity throughout the facility
Administer and maintain Windows Active Directory environment and related Microsoft infrastructure
Manage smartphone and mobile device deployments using enterprise mobility management solutions
Implement and maintain RF (Radio Frequency) technology infrastructure, including handheld scanners and mobile computers
Strategic Planning and Project Management
Align IT strategy and roadmap for the Fulfillment Center to meet requirements established by local Operations leadership
Identify, evaluate, recommend, and implement cost-effective technology solutions that support business growth
Lead and participate in technology projects, managing priorities and ensuring successful delivery within established timelines
Work closely with company executives to understand business requirements and translate them into effective technology implementations
Manage vendor relationships, contracts, and service agreements to ensure optimal service delivery and cost management
On-Call and Emergency Response
Participate in 24/7 on-call support rotation, responding to critical IT issues outside of standard business hours
Respond to emergency situations and perform incident management as needed
Ensure business continuity through effective disaster recovery planning and execution
Maintain readiness to come in for emergency coverage as required
Essential Qualifications
To succeed in this role at arenaflex, candidates must possess a combination of formal education, relevant experience, and demonstrated technical competencies. We seek professionals who are passionate about technology and committed to operational excellence.
Education
Bachelor's or Graduate degree in Computer Science, Information Technology, or a related technical field
Experience Requirements
Minimum of 4 years of experience providing technical support in a Fulfillment Center, Warehouse, or similar high-volume distribution environment
Demonstrated success in leading and managing IT Support teams
Proven track record of managing vendor relationships, contracts, and service level agreements
Experience supporting computers in a Windows Active Directory environment
Background in a SLA-driven environment with demonstrated ability to meet performance targets
Technical Knowledge
Extensive knowledge of Motorola/Zebra RF Units, including models such as Moto MC9190, VC6090, and WT41N0
Expertise in Microsoft Network technologies and enterprise solutions
Proficiency in Smartphone and Mobile Device Management (MDM)
Advanced knowledge of RF Technologies and their applications in warehouse environments
Working knowledge of SOTI MobiControl or similar enterprise device management platforms
Networking and Infrastructure
Comprehensive understanding of networking concepts including DNS, DHCP, HTTP, SSL, OSI Model, and TCP/IP protocols
Experience with data cabling and PC facilities maintenance
Cisco CCNA certification or equivalent experience
Understanding of network architecture and security principles
Certifications (Preferred)
Microsoft certifications such as MCSE (Microsoft Certified Solutions Expert), MCSA (Microsoft Certified Solutions Associate), or MCITP (Microsoft Certified IT Professional)
Cisco CCNA or higher networking certifications
Additional industry-relevant certifications are a plus
